problems accessing utf8 encoded databases



Hi:

I'm new to this list and to postgres, so hopefully this won't sound like a  
stupid question. We are trying to connect from sas 9.13 service pack 3 to a 
postgres database version 8.2.4. We are able to do so without any problems when 
the databases are sql-ascii encoded, but get 

ERROR: CLI error trying to establish connection: [unixODBC]client encoding 
mismatch

I'm able to connect to the same server, different databases that are not UTF-8 
encoded. I have UNICODE=UTF8 as a line in the odbc.ini. We are calling the sas9 
program with a utf-8 encoding option. T

We are using 8.00.0100, but from what I've read it looks like utf-8 support 
started in version 7.1. I didn't install the driver myself, but is there 
something special I need to do to get utf-8 working with the odbc driver?
